js中ajax,js中ajax请求
作者:admin日期:2024-01-04 10:45:09浏览:46分类:资讯
什么是AJAX?
AJAX 是与服务器交换数据并更新部分网页的艺术,在不重新加载整个页面的情况下。
类似于DHTML或LAMP,AJAX不是指一种单一的技术,而是有机地利用了一系列相关的技术。事实上,一些基于AJAX的“派生/合成”式(derivative/posite)的技术正在出现,如“AFLAX”。
AJAX是一种用于创建交互式web应用程序的web开发技术。Ajax=异步JavaScript和XML或HTML(标准通用标记语言的子集)。可用于创建快速动态网页的技术。无需重新加载整个网页即可更新部分网页的技术。
Ajax怎样实现网页异步更新
1、操作一般就是直接操作DOM,所以AJAX能做到所谓的“无刷新”用户体验。
2、所谓的异步刷新,就是不刷新整个网页进行更新数据。
3、Ajax的局部刷新 AJAX异步加载,通过在后台与服务器进行少量数据交换,Ajax 可以使网页实现异步更新。意味着可以在不重新加载整个网页的情况下,对网页的某部分进行更新。操作方法如下:首先创建2个测试文件。
4、而通过js就能打开一个URL地址并且获得响应的信息。这些信息被JS捕获到后,就可以通过JS把它们按照一个规则组合并显示在页面上。这一个过程就叫做Ajax的异步刷新。你要真实感受这个过程,你得用js实际操作下才行。
axios和ajax区别
ajax本身是针对mvc编程,不符合现在前端mvvm的浪潮, 基于原生XHR开发,XHR本身的架构不清晰,不符合关注分离的原则,配置和调用方式非常混乱,而且基于事件的异步模型不友好。
都要学。ajax和axios都是属于应用于网页的HTTP库,只要学习前端框架的课程,这两个时都要学习的。axios是一个基于Promise的HTTP库,而ajax是对原生XHR的封装。ajax技术实现了局部数据的刷新,而axios实现了对ajax的封装。
ajax只是一种技术实现方式,之前一般是指jquery封装的ajax方法。在vue中,可以使用axios代替,也可以自己封装一个类似的ajax方法。封装异步传输方法一般需使用XMLHttpRequest对象或fetch等方法实现。
其次 ,加上请求头设置。 axios ajax 这个时候返回的是200,且能获取返回的信息。前端应该根据信息去重定向。
ajax和javascript有什么区别
1、javascript是一种在客户端执行的脚本语言。ajax是基于javascript的一种技术,它主要用途是提供异步刷新(只刷新页面的一部分,而不是整个页面都刷新)。
2、javascript是一种用于浏览器的脚本语言,它的主要功能分dom和bom操作两种,前者用于对网页文档进行操作,后者对于浏览器对象进行操作,它们都具有丰富多彩的强大效果。
3、Ajax的一个最大的特点是无需刷新页面便可向服务器传输或读写数据(又称无刷新更新页面),这一特点主要得益于XMLHTTP组件XMLHTTPRequest对象。
4、对网页的某部分进行更新;Javascript是一个开发语言,在使用ajax技术中,需要使用到它;Ajax和javascript的区别就是,ajax是一种多技术的综合使用(其中包含了javascript),javascript只是一种脚本语言。
5、javascript是一种语言,ajax是封装的javascript,底层也是javascript代码。只是在语法上有些不一样。
谁能够帮我详细的介绍一下ajax啊?
异步的Javascript和xml(Asynchronous JavaScript and XML)。AJAX并不是一门新的语言或技术,它实际上是几项技术按照一定的方式组合在一起,相互协作并且发挥各自的作用。
用户单击Done之后,就可以发出一个Ajax请求来更新服务器,并刷新表格,使其包含静态、只读的数据。 一切皆有可能!但愿它能够激发您开始开发自己的基于Ajax的站点。
XMLHttpRequest是ajax的核心机制,它是在IE5中首先引入的,是一种支持异步请求的技术。简单的说,也就是javascript可以及时向服务器提出请求和处理响应,而不阻塞用户。达到无刷新的效果。
ajax的工作原理就是通过XmlHttpRequest对象来向服务器发出异步请求,从服务器中获得数据,然后用Javascript来操作DOM从而更新局部页面Ajax是一种无需重新加载整个网页,能够更新部分网页的技术。
AJAX简介 AJAX(Asynchronous Javascript And XML)翻译成中文就是“异步的Javascript和XML”。即使用Javascript语言与服务器进行异步交互,传输的数据为XML(当然,传输的数据不只是XML)。
下面给大家介绍几个实例,首先应该分为两类: 在用表单和ajax都可以完成某个功能时,只是使用ajax更加的快速、方便。
如何确保JavaScript的执行顺序
首先,读者应该清楚,HTML文档在浏览器中的解析过程是这样的:浏览器是按着文档流从上到下逐步解析页面结构和信息的。
引言 在上一篇文章《如何确保JavaScript的执行顺序 - 之jQuery.html深度分析》中,我们揭示了jQuery.html函数之所以能在各种浏览器下保持动态JS顺序执行,其秘密在于 _ 同步AJAX获取外部JavaScript。
JavaScript代码执行顺序是按照代码从上到下的顺序执行的。在函数调用时,会先执行当前函数内部的语句,然后再执行外部函数的语句。如果有嵌套函数,则会从内到外依次执行。
函数调用及执行。所以这个就看编写顺序。var a = 12;function b(){alert(1)};js操作:(自我理解)var a;function b(){alert(1)};上面都是声明。然后是调用:a=12;b();谁写到前面谁先。
猜你还喜欢
- 04-18 ajax是干什么的,ajax 是啥
- 04-17 css和js有何区别,js和css和html
- 04-16 邮箱正则表达式解读,邮箱正则表达式 js
- 04-07 js文字动画特效,js 文字特效
- 03-19 js跨域问题的三种解决方案,js解决跨域的三种方法
- 03-10 java和js,java和jsp的区别
- 03-06 js框架排行榜,js框架哪个好
- 03-06 js数组合并,js数组合并concat的用法
- 03-05 vue表单自定义验证,vue表单验证并发送请求
- 02-28 js快速入门,js入门基础
- 02-26 js中substring,js中substring1,2
- 02-25 ajax跨域设置请求头,ajax跨域请求头配置
取消回复欢迎 你 发表评论:
- 最近发表
- 标签列表
- 友情链接
暂无评论,来添加一个吧。